What Is A Christmas Tree . It’s roots come from pagan traditions, but it became a christian symbol in the 16th century. Christmas tree, an evergreen tree, often a pine or a fir, decorated with lights and ornaments as a part of christmas festivities.

The christmas tree is considered by some as christianisation of pagan tradition and ritual surrounding the winter solstice, which included the use of evergreen boughs, and an adaptation of pagan tree worship; It’s roots come from pagan traditions, but it became a christian symbol in the 16th century.
